SchoolRow ranks Rosedale Elementary 2,524th of 5,659 California elementary schools for 2024–25, based on CAASPP 2024–25 English and Math results — better than 55% of elementary schools statewide. Its statewide percentile went from 58th in 2015 to 55th in 2025.

NCES history for this school begins in 1987. Race categories changed by 2010: earlier data combines Asian and Pacific Islander students and does not consistently identify multiracial students. The chart retains that history, while the change table uses 2010 onward.

What school district is Rosedale Elementary in?

Rosedale Elementary is part of the Chico Unified district in Chico, California.

Is Rosedale Elementary a good school?

SchoolRow ranks Rosedale Elementary 2,524th of 5,659 California elementary schools (better than 55% statewide) based on 2024–25 test results (CAASPP 2024–25).

What is the racial makeup of Rosedale Elementary?

Hispanic 69%, White 21%, Two or more races 9% (555 students, 2023–24).
